William Reid BRODIE

BRODIE, William Reid

Service Number: 2345
Enlisted: 2 June 1915
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 15th Machine Gun Company
Born: Coupar Angus, Perth and Kindross, Scotland, 1891
Home Town: Melbourne, Melbourne, Victoria
Schooling: Not yet discovered
Occupation: Draper
Died: Killed in Action, France, 19 July 1916
Cemetery: Laventie Military Cemetery, la Gorgue
Plot II, Row G, Grave No. 22
Memorials: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our
